Welcome to the Relvane release team. Before each cut, we run the leaked-file-descriptor hunt on the Quillbase staging pool. The tooling snapshots open descriptors per worker, diffs them against the baseline, and flags anything the Harbrook daemon failed to close. As release manager, you sign off on the diff report before tagging. If the hunt tooling's sealed config store is locked, you will need the recovery passphrase to reopen it. For convenience during onboarding, it is recorded directly below.

vault phrase of bagaf-kajeg = jorath-feniel-briir-siliel-ralix

Q: My plugin's print jobs get stuck in "queued" — what gives?

A: Nine times out of ten, the Spoolhaus microservice is rejecting your job manifest silently (yeah, we know). Check that your payload declares a media size and that your plugin registered a callback endpoint. The validation rules and error codes are documented on our partner portal page.

wiki page, hahif-hahif: https://argocd.kelvisys.corp/browse/board/settings/pages/1442e0b1065d83f1

## Service Accounts — StormFan Alert Fan-Out

The fan-out worker authenticates to the internal dispatch tier using the svc-stormfan account. Rotate quarterly; scopes are limited to publish-only on alert topics. If deliveries stall during your shift, verify the worker is using the current credential, reproduced below for reference.

API key for kaweg-hahif: kto4_rAjZ